Shobhada

Shobhada is a village located in Boram subdivision of Purbi Singhbhum district in Jharkhand, India. It is situated 22km away from district headquarter Boram. Boram is the sub-district headquarter of Shobhada village. As per 2009 stats, Beldih is the gram panchayat of Shobhada village.

About Shobhada

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Shobhada is 363328. The village spans a total geographical area of 91 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 832105. Jamshedpur is nearest town to Shobhada village for all major economic activities.

Population of Shobhada

According to the 2011 Census, Shobhada has a total population of about 274, with approximately 141 males and 133 females. The sex ratio is around 943 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 38 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. Details about the Scheduled Castes (SC) community are not available.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 214. The overall literacy rate is approximately 46.35%, with male literacy at about 53.19% and female literacy near 39.10%. There are around 51 households in the village. Together, these details offer a clear picture of Shobhada's population size, gender balance, young residents, literacy levels, and social makeup.

Connectivity of Shobhada

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Shobhada. As per the 2011 stats, Shobhada had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within <5 km distance
Private Bus Service Available within <5 km distance
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
